I am get this error message "There is nothing to plan." while creating a production order from sale order planning..
*This post is locked for comments
Which Reordering Policy you are using? A "demand" (Prod. Order, Sales Order etc.) should exist for the planning lines to be generated.
Also check the "Replenishment System" is set to "Prod. Order".
